Learn to construct a cost-effective DIY weld bend tester in this 23-minute tutorial that provides a budget-friendly alternative to expensive commercial testing equipment. Follow step-by-step instructions for building your own bend tester using downloadable DXF files that can be cut with CNC plasma tables or laser cutting services. Discover the fundamentals of weld bend testing and understand why this quality assessment method is essential for welding projects. Compare plasma cutting versus laser cutting techniques for fabricating the tester components, then master the cleaning and preparation processes for cut metal parts. Practice both MIG and TIG welding techniques during the tack welding phases of assembly, followed by final welding and assembly procedures. Explore hydraulic jack fitting and modification techniques to complete the functional testing apparatus. Witness the first test bend demonstration and receive practical recommendations for DIY fabrication projects. Access comprehensive cost breakdowns to understand the financial benefits of building versus purchasing commercial bend testing equipment, with detailed guidance on material selection and construction methods for creating professional-quality welding test equipment at home.
